War for the Liberation of Algeria, 1959. Philippe Roussel, a French officer attracted by Marxist ideas, goes over to the side of the Algerian partisans and becomes a double agent. This parody of Bond, generously seasoned with political satire, is the third novel by the British medieval historian and orientalist Robert Irwin, author of the acclaimed "The Arabian Nightmare."
